Output 81f33082acac4e41138561edadb12237553c955b59f72deb6f739f546cfe2c23:1

value
702668156
script pubkey
OP_0 OP_PUSHBYTES_20 7d14821e2b789b9ef9ecb94ac45d88b0bb50e343
address
bc1q052gy83t0zdea70vh99vghvgkza4pc6rrgyd8w
transaction
81f33082acac4e41138561edadb12237553c955b59f72deb6f739f546cfe2c23